> It should work, really. Yes, it isn't super fast, but for small amounts of
data and users, it should really be fine.

Not really from my experience. :-/ You will have locking issues and similar,
especially when using the sync client. Furthermore the file locking stuff
which is now handled within the db by default is putting even more load to
the database.

> If it isn't that's a bug we should fix!

The initial issue where "General error: 14 unable to open database file" is
logged is probably more an environmental issue with missing access
permissions or similar:
